Welcome to the National Charter School Resource Center (NCSRC) funding opportunity database. The database includes one-time and ongoing national grants, fellowships, and scholarships that are currently active. Sponsors include the U.S. Federal Government and philanthropic organizations. This page is updated frequently as charter school funding opportunities are announced. Funding opportunities are displayed below in order of due date, i.e., opportunities with the most imminent deadlines are listed first and alphabetically within the same due date range.

Please note that state-specific and currently inactive funding opportunities are excluded from this database. For information about state-specific funding opportunities, please visit State Resources for Charter Schools on the NCSRC website to contact your State Education Agency and, if applicable, your state’s Charter Support Organization. For more information about federal funding opportunities, please visit Accessing Federal Programs: A Guidebook for Charter School Operators and Developers.
